V. CONCLUSION

Nos résultats soulignent l’intérêt de disposer de modèles expérimentaux reproductibles et étudiés de façon multimodale pour mieux comprendre le rôle des MHC, ces petites lésions longtemps considérées silencieuses et qui se révèlent finalement à l’origine d’un déclin cognitif, mais également d’une interaction probable avec les lésions neurodégénératives. Nous avons mis en évidence la possibilité de limiter cet impact par une modulation pharmacologique par atorvastatine, ce qui encourage à étudier, toujours grâce à notre modèle, d’autres pistes thérapeutiques qui pourraient à terme être proposées en clinique. Nos résultats viennent étoffer les données disponibles dans la littérature sur la caractérisation de l’impact d’une MHC et d’un traitement par statine sur la cognition. Plusieurs points méritent d’être complétés, au regard de ces travaux et des travaux de Yao Chen, réalisés en parallèle chez la souris femelle : les mécanismes précis doivent être analysés pour mieux caractériser les évènements physiopathologiques à l’origine des conséquences de ces petites lésions

vasculaires. L’influence du sexe sur l’impact de la MHC ainsi que la modulation par atorvastatine doivent également être étudiées de près, ainsi que le poids de certains facteurs de risque vasculaire.
